Output ef9f476812bc1979f8c65dccb0cbb8db300419b618a26418d1552a4ee1ab6b7a:3

value
1081629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ab8f2932730745b01e65b6ecc8dba3321caad743 OP_EQUAL
address
3HL8yLogYhfaftyKZ2ojb7sXQqFbLbWy8Z
transaction
ef9f476812bc1979f8c65dccb0cbb8db300419b618a26418d1552a4ee1ab6b7a
confirmations
90741
spent
true